Passphrase Dependency — Owner Death
Cases where recovery required a BIP39 passphrase or wallet encryption passphrase that was not stored independently of the device or seed phrase. This page shows archive cases where both conditions were present.
61% of all Owner Death cases in the archive involve this structural dependency. Among them, 80% of determinate cases resulted in a blocked outcome. The most common recovery path is estate process.
